How to Install Ghost on a CentOS Server
Ghost is an open source and free blogging platform. It is simple to use and comes with a wealth of options that make it simple to manage your blog's content.
Use the following command in the terminal to begin. This will install the core files for Ghost and also create an account on your local computer.
You can use the Settings Staff - Invite People menu to add new users to your team. Each user has different permissions depending on their role.
Ghost is installed on Digital Ocean.
Ghost is a well-known platform for blogging that allows users to build their own website without extensive technical knowledge. Its user-friendly interface makes it easy to customize your blog's design and manage your content. The platform has SEO settings and integrations to improve your website's visibility.
Installing Ghost is simple and fast. Log in to your DigitalOcean Account and then click on the "Droplets page". Select the "One Click" option to create Ghost Droplets. This will automatically launch and create a server. You can access your web-based application via the console after the Ghost droplet is created.
Once you've logged in, you will be required to set up a MySQL database for Ghost. Enter the hostname, database name and password when asked. You'll also need to input a config file for the application.
This file is your blog's home directory as well as theme files. After you've completed these settings, you'll be able start writing posts and publishing them to your blog. You can edit your config file to alter the site's appearance.
Ghost will ask for the admin username and password as along with the title of your website. Once you have completed these steps the web application is now ready to use. You can view your new blog by visiting 127.0.0.1:2368/ghost.
Once you've set up your Ghost blog, it's now time to install an SSL certificate. To do this, open the console in your Ghost web application and execute the following command:
Installing Ghost on Ubuntu

Ghost is an open-source blogging platform designed for content publishers. It is lightweight and fast, and it provides a clean and intuitive user interface for editing and writing content. It also has an Markdown editor themes that can be customized or developed from scratch, and search engine optimization (SEO) features. It can accommodate multiple users roles, role and permissions. This makes it perfect for collaborative projects.
Before installing Ghost, make sure that your VPS has enough resources to run the CMS. Smaller VPS instances could have memory issues when there is a large amount of traffic or processing large imports. You can prevent this issue by creating an ad-hoc file that allocates additional virtual memory to your system. cost of ghost immobiliser will avoid errors caused by memory loss and allow your website to continue running smoothly.
During the installation, you will be asked to enter your Ghost site's hostname, password and email address. This information is required for logging into the Ghost dashboard to manage your website. Ghost-cli will enable SSL using Let'sEncrypt during the setting process. You can also add SSL later on by running ghost setup ssl any time. You will be asked to enable systemd, which is a tool for managing processes and makes Ghost run smoothly. Selecting yes will install all dependencies.
You can launch Ghost via the command line once you have completed the installation. Enter the following command to start Ghost by typing: ghost start hostname> -d /var/www/ghost -s
Once you've entered this, you may then detach your screen session and start Ghost in the background.
When you first launch Ghost, it will display an initial welcome page, which includes the URL of your blog. Once you have verified your identity, it is possible to start writing and publishing content on your website. You can also create and personalize your site's theme to reflect your brand. You can also create a newsletter to reach out to your customers. With the power of Ghost, you can build an impressive and effective online presence. You can even use Ghost to build an income-generating business around your content.
Installing Ghost on CentOS
Ghost is a brand new content management system that's built specifically for blogging. It's light and fast, with many features that other CMS systems don't have. This guide will show you how to install Ghost onto a CentOS server. Before you begin you'll require a VPS with root access and a basic understanding of how to use the Linux command line.
Log in to your server via SSH. Then, move into the directory where you want to install Ghost. Then, run the following command in order to download the most recent Ghost version. Include the --production option when you run the command to install dependencies that are dependent on production.
After you've completed the installation you'll have to set up Nginx to serve your Ghost blog. Nginx will handle sending requests to Ghost and setting up headers that show the IP address of every visitor. This will prevent someone from hiding their identity using an untrue address.
You'll need to set up a Ghost database before you can start serving your website's content to the public. Open the command line, and type in the following command.
After you've created an account for your Ghost site you can start the server by entering the following command:
Create an admin account and password for Ghost. autowatch ghost 2 immobiliser for Ghost is secret. However, it's advised to use a solid unique password that contains at least one uppercase, one lowercase, and one zero. If you're not sure how to do this then consult the official Ghost documentation.
Once your website is running You'll need to make it search engine friendly. This will improve your chances of getting found by potential readers. Go to Settings and then Meta data and then Edit. You can input the meta title and description, as well as the canonical URL for your site here.
If you plan to host multiple Ghost sites on the same server, you should think about implementing a proxy like Varnish or Nginx. This will allow you to expand your site as it expands. You can also use a service like Cloudflare to safeguard your website from DDoS attacks.
Installing Ghost on Debian
Ghost is a brand new blogging platform that was designed with a single purpose in mind: to offer users with a beautiful, simple and user-friendly platform to share their thoughts and opinions on the world of digital. It was created almost entirely by volunteers and is operated by a non-profit organisation. Ghost is a relatively new blogging platform, however it has already gained the reputation of being an excellent choice for those who want to begin.
Unlike other content management systems, which typically require a significant amount of time and effort to install and set up, Ghost is extremely easy to install and use. This is because it has been designed to be as simple as possible. It has a default theme and a set of default templates, which can be customized to fit any taste. It is equipped with features that optimize the site for search engines and facilitate social media sharing.
To get started you'll require a VPS with root access and an SSH client. Log into the server, and then run this command to install Ghost. After the installation is complete you can begin to run the web app by using the npm command npm start. Once the web app is running, you can visit http://use_your_droplet_ip/ghost to see your newly-setup Ghost home page. You'll need to enter your site's title, name, and e-mail address, as well as a username and password in order to access the administration interface.
After signing in, you are able to modify the website by adding posts and pages. You can also add widgets and alter the theme. To make your website more SEO-friendly, you can enhance the meta data of each page and post by selecting Settings Metadata Edit. This allows you to add a description along with an official URL.
When you are ready to publish, you can register your custom domain and begin publishing your content. You can also set up SMTP so that your site can send and receive email. This can be done by putting smtp information into the section titled "environment" of your Ghost server. If you're concerned about out-of-memory issues, you can create a swap file to allocate virtual memory.